Labor like a good soldier of Christ Jesus.
No man, acting as a soldier for God, entangles himself in worldly matters, so that he may be pleasing to him for whom he has proven himself.
Then, too, whoever strives in a competition is not crowned, unless he has competed lawfully.
The farmer who labors ought to be the first to share in the produce.
Understand what I am saying. For the Lord will give you understanding in all things.
Be mindful that the Lord Jesus Christ, who is the offspring of David, has risen again from the dead, according to my Gospel.
I labor in this Gospel, even while chained like an evildoer. But the Word of God is not bound.
